Abstract
The utility model discloses a quenching cooling oil tank with multi-section cooling function, which comprises a frame body, an oil tank is placed in the frame body, a pipe bracket is fixedly installed on the surface of the outer wall of the frame body, an oil supply pipe is placed on the top of the pipe bracket, a bolt is fixedly installed on the surface of the outer wall of the oil supply pipe, an aluminum-plastic pipe movable joint is fixedly installed on the top of the oil supply pipe, a heat-resistant aluminum-plastic pipe is fixedly installed on the top of the aluminum-plastic pipe movable joint, and a waterproof cable connecting pipe is fixedly installed on one side of the oil tank; through the support line roller of design, have a plurality of support line rollers in the oil tank, for high temperature resistant ceramic material, the position is adjustable about the change according to the steel wire diameter, prevents that the steel wire from shaking and the cooling that arouses is inhomogeneous, and cooling oil groove leading-out terminal is equipped with the air-blowing device, with the quenching oil clean up on steel wire surface, has solved the problem that the steel wire can rock in inside.

Background
A surface heat treatment process for quenching the surface of steel workpiece features that the surface of steel workpiece is quickly heated to austenitize the surface layer of workpiece, then quickly quenched to transform the surface layer structure to martensite, the core structure is basically unchanged, and after surface quenching, low-temp tempering is performed.

Referring to fig. 1-3, the present invention provides a technical solution: the utility model provides a quenching cooling oil tank with multistage cooling function, includes support body 1, oil tank 2 has been placed to support body 1's inside, and the fixed surface of support body 1 outer wall installs conduit saddle 4, and fuel feed pipe 3 has been placed at conduit saddle 4's top, and the fixed surface who supplies 3 outer walls of fuel feed pipe installs bolt 5, and fuel feed pipe 3's top fixed mounting has plastic-aluminum pipe movable joint 9, and plastic-aluminum pipe movable joint 9's top fixed mounting has heat-resisting plastic-aluminum pipe 8, and one side fixed mounting of oil tank 2 has waterproof cable to take over 10.
In this embodiment, oil quenching cooling device comprises cooling oil groove, oil feed pipe 3 and support body 1 etc. and is full of quenching oil in the cooling oil groove, contains multistage cooling shower nozzle, and cooling rate is fast and even, has guaranteed product tissue transition and mechanical properties, and cooling shower nozzle has the central adjustment function to make things convenient for the change of cooling head, adjustment simultaneously in keeping the refrigerated homogeneity of steel wire, thereby can improve work efficiency.
Specifically, the fixed surface of the outer wall of the oil tank 2 is provided with a thermometer 6 and an electric pressure gauge 7, the internal thread of the frame body 1 is provided with an easily nailed bolt 11, and the fixed surface of the outer wall of the oil tank 2 is provided with a pressure gauge 12.
In this embodiment, have a plurality of support line rollers in the oil tank 2, for high temperature resistant ceramic material, the position is adjustable about the change according to the steel wire diameter, prevents that the steel wire from trembling and the cooling that arouses is inhomogeneous, and cooling oil groove outlet end is equipped with the air-blowing device, with the quenching oil clean up on steel wire surface.
Specifically, the cooling oil groove has been seted up to the inside of oil tank 2, and the inside fixed mounting of oil groove has the multistage cooling shower nozzle.
In this embodiment, through setting up multistage cooling shower nozzle for cooling rate is fast and even, has guaranteed product tissue transition and mechanical properties, thereby can improve work efficiency.
Specifically, the wire supporting roller is fixedly arranged inside the oil tank 2, and the wire outlet end of the cooling oil tank is provided with the blowing device.
In this embodiment, because the wire supporting roller is high temperature resistant ceramic material, the position is adjustable from top to bottom according to the change of the steel wire diameter, prevents that the steel wire shakes and the cooling that causes is inhomogeneous.
Specifically, the length of cooling oil groove is ten meters, and the inside fixed welding of cooling oil groove has square pipe and steel sheet.
In this embodiment, the cooling oil groove is set to ten meters, so that the fault-tolerant efficiency of the device is improved.
Specifically, a connecting hole is formed in the pipe bracket 4, and the section of the connecting hole is circular.
In this embodiment, through setting up the connecting hole for fuel feeding pipe 3 can fixed mounting at the top of conduit saddle 4, has both solved the connection problem, has solved the installation problem again.
